How much Coke a day is OK?
However, you would need to drink more than six 12-ounce (355-ml) cans of Coke or four 12-ounce (355-ml) cans of Diet Coke per day to reach this amount. 400 mg of caffeine daily is considered safe for most adults, but cutting your intake to 200 mg daily can help reduce your risk of adverse side effects.

How much Coke should you drink a week?
The American Heart Association recommends consuming no more than 450 calories from sugar sweetened beverages per week (the amount in three cans of cola).

Can you get addicted to Coca-Cola?
Food addictions — including soda addiction — can have many behaviors in common with drug addiction ( 2 ). Because soda contains several potentially habit-forming substances like caffeine, sodium, and sugar or artificial sweeteners, it's easier to become dependent on soda than you might think ( 3 , 4 , 5 , 6 ).

How much does Coke make a year?
CocaCola revenue for the twelve months ending March 31, 2022 was $40.126B, a 20.02% increase year-over-year. CocaCola annual revenue for 2021 was $38.655B, a 17.09% increase from 2020. CocaCola annual revenue for 2020 was $33.014B, a 11.41% decline from 2019.
Which state drinks the most Coca-Cola?
Mississippi
More than 41% of Mississippi adults reported more-than-daily consumption of regular soda or fruit drinks, by far the highest percentage among states reviewed.
